| | | | | | | | Purpose:
Discussion and possible action to award a contract in the amount of $1,805,008 to contractor, Nesbitt Contracting Company, Inc. pursuant to Job Order Contract, ACON09322 for Pavement Maintenance and Repair Services for 83rd Avenue; Thunderbird Road to Skunk Creek Bridge. |
| | | | | | | | Summary:
A technical survey was completed and presented to City Council on March 3, 2021 as part of the Public Works Streets Division’s Pavement Management Program. The survey information was used to prioritize needed treatment schedules based on operational goals and objectives that are part of the lifecycle maintenance program. The evaluation of 83rd Avenue, Thunderbird Road to Skunk Creek Bridge indicated age and cracking have degraded the road beyond a preservation treatment. The survey results indicated this section of road as a priority in this fiscal year to restore pavement surface conditions. Recommended treatment of this roadway section is a mill and overlay using high-volume asphalt concrete. This "mill and overlay" will eliminate multiple distresses, provide a smoother riding surface, and extend the pavement lifecycle. |
| | | | | | | | Previous Actions/Background:
The City Council received a presentation on the City's Pavement Management Program at the March 3, 2021 Study Session. The method of contractor selection was in accordance with the City of Peoria policies and applicable authority as overseen by the Materials Management Division of the Budget and Finance Department. A Request for Proposals was issued in 2021 to select two (2) Job Order Contractors for ongoing Pavement Maintenance and Repair Services for the Public Works/Streets Department. Nesbitt Contracting Company, Inc. was selected during this competitive RFP process and was subsequently selected for this project based on their past positive performance with the City and their expertise with Pavement Maintenance and Repair projects. |
